Adopt a Spectrum of Greys and White
Using a spectrum of greys along with white creates a fresh, modern contrast, ideal for a masculine ambiance. Imagine a charcoal headboard set against white walls, creating a powerful focal point.

Make Use of Contrasting Walls
Consider half-painting your walls with grey and white for a distinctive and modern touch. This method visually expands the room, providing a sleek, contemporary vibe.

Introduce Comfort With Wood
Combine grey shades with rustic wood to create a cozy, welcoming space. The natural wood introduces an organic contrast, adding a layer of complexity to the room.
